Why Reformer Pilates?
Reformer Pilates is more than just a workout—it’s a whole-body, low-impact training method that builds strength, improves flexibility, supports posture and enhances overall mind-body connection. It’s ideal for people at all fitness levels and especially beneficial for those looking to ease back into movement after a busy summer or a long break.
Clients love the way Reformer Pilates helps them:
Build strength and tone muscles without the bulk
Improve posture and reduce everyday aches and pains
Restore focus and mental clarity through mindful movement
Re-establish consistency in their wellness routines
Creating a Healthy Routine That Sticks
September is a great time to lay the groundwork for a sustainable fitness routine. Rather than jumping into high-intensity training or setting unrealistic goals, many of my clients find that scheduling two to three Reformer sessions per week helps them ease into a rhythm that feels energising—not overwhelming.
Plus, Pilates isn’t just a seasonal fix—it’s a lifestyle investment. The benefits build over time and many clients find that the sense of physical and mental balance it brings helps them stay grounded through the busy coming months.
Tips for Getting Started This September:
Start Small: Book one or two classes per week to begin with. You can always add more as you get into the swing of things.
Treat It as Self-Care: Don’t think of your Pilates class as just another appointment—see it as a commitment to yourself.
Stay Consistent: Whether you’re coming in once a week or three times, consistency is key to seeing results and feeling the difference.
Pair It with Healthy Habits: Pilates works beautifully alongside other wellness habits—hydration, nourishing meals and quality of sleep.
